Atlanta, June 17 (UNI) Chelsea kicked off its Club World Cup campaign with a comfortable 2-0 win against LAFA in a half-empty Mercedes Benz Stadium here.
Chelsea was the better side, although LAFC looked to move the ball around against a rival that started the match with three of its four new signings on the bench.
Chelsea had to withstand a bright start from LAFC in a ground where there were far too many empty seats, but after around 15 minutes the Conference League champions began to get control of midfield on Tuesday.
